Transaction fdcb2dec641366f2fd3506809912eae9aa5f4d30412379a4153c3aab146e2b7e
1 Input
1 Output
-
fdcb2dec641366f2fd3506809912eae9aa5f4d30412379a4153c3aab146e2b7e:0
- value
- 1089908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e9d40de5cc163248ec0d2361ee29f539f9f200f OP_EQUAL
- address
- 34UtaTQ6jkyd6rjwPWXBbM4G78HHKYBYVP